Understanding Impound Fees and Payment Options in Parkgate
If your vehicle has been towed in Parkgate, it's crucial to be aware of the costs associated with recovering your car. Typical release fees can vary, but you should expect to pay around £150 to £300 depending on the impound location. Daily storage charges apply, which often range from £20 to £30 per day. These fees add up quickly, so acting promptly is in your best interest. If you find yourself in the unfortunate situation of having your vehicle wrongfully towed, understanding your rights is essential. Drivers are entitled to dispute the tow, particularly if proper signage was not posted or if the tow was not justified. Gather evidence such as photographs and any relevant documentation to support your case, as this can aid in the dispute process. Local authorities, including those managing parking at Middle Road, have procedures in place to address grievances regarding towing incidents. When pursuing compensation, ensure you file your complaint with the appropriate authorities. For detailed information, you can refer to the issue details regarding local parking. Remember, acting swiftly is crucial to resolving such matters, and always document your communications for future reference.
